Zarb-e-Azb: 13 militants killed in fresh air strikes

RAWALPINDI: At least 13 militants were killed in fresh air strikes carried out by Pakistan’s military jet fighters in Mir Ali area of North Waziristan tribal region during the ongoing military operation ‘Zarb-e-Azb’ on Wednesday, the Inter Service Public Relations (ISPR) said.

The ISPR said that five hideouts of the militants were also destroyed in air strikes.

Meanwhile, 12 militants surrendered to security forces in the tribal region.

Number of IDP families reaches 36,793

A total of 441 more families comprising 4,916 individuals have been registered as the internally displaced persons (IDPs) in Bannu and its adjacent districts of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a.

The sources of the FATA Disaster Management Authority (FDMA) said that the total number of IDPs families has now reached to 36,793 families comprising 455,597 individuals.
